Output 8d97e8f0f857de1d296655b376a83330c5900659df5b257b63dfb04bd12330ba:1

value
954900
script pubkey
OP_HASH160 OP_PUSHBYTES_20 11f66e058275ea5d7dd9c60c6aaf13bb6dfcce33 OP_EQUAL
address
33Kzd3bZS2zoteYyLgecz69hHMEiBktF4w
transaction
8d97e8f0f857de1d296655b376a83330c5900659df5b257b63dfb04bd12330ba
confirmations
340943
spent
true